Broken Noses (1987) This documentary follows former Golden Gloves boxing champion Andy Minsker as he trains hopeful pugilists at the Mount Scott boxing club in Portland, Oregon. Those hoping to master the gentle art receive guidance and philosophical insight from the colorful Minsker. Let's Get Lost (1988) Let's Get Lost is a deep Oscar-nominated documentary on the life of jazz trumpeter Chet Baker (1929-1988). After a generous amount of screen time devoted to Baker's American career, from his days with Charlie 'Bird' Parker and Gerry Mulligan to the formation of his own combo, the film dwells upon Baker's lengthy tenure in Europe. Of particular interest are the clips culled from Baker's appearances in Italian films of the 1960s. In-depth interviews with Baker's friends and co-workers paint a portrait of a troubled genius, whose drug addiction and womanizing gradually eroded his talent. Much of the terminal footage is literally that, showing in harsh detail what Chet Baker had become in his last year on earth. Chop Suey (2001) In this autobiographical film, Bruce Weber looks back on his career as both photographer and filmmaker. A photographer never knows where their work will take them; this photographer has ended up in the most incredible places - from the catwalks of the world's fashion capitals to the remotest parts of the Arabian desert.
